Through a partnership between USQ and TAFE, you will graduate from your degree with two qualifications – a Diploma of Hospitality from TAFE and a Bachelor of Business (Marketing and Hospitality Management) from USQ.

You will first complete a Diploma of Hospitality at TAFE or an equivalent accredited body, and then apply directly to USQ to complete your Bachelor of Business courses. 

With practical industry experience in hospitality at TAFE, combined with a thorough understanding of the principles and practices of contemporary marketing through your USQ degree, you will have all the necessary knowledge and skills to manage any hospitality environment.

Why Marketing and Hospitality Management?

With hospitality one of Australia’s largest industries, the Marketing and Hospitality Management specialisation will give you the skills you need to take on management and executive roles within a thriving sector.

1 In order to complete the Marketing and Hospitality Management major, you need to have successfully completed a diploma from a TAFE institution or equivalent accredited body. These diplomas replace the need for a second major. 

 

Entry requirements

  • Year 12 English (4 SA) or equivalent
  • Maths A (4 SA) or equivalent is assumed

English Language Requirements

Domestic and international students from a non-English speaking background are required to satisfy English Language requirements. This program requires a minimum of IELTS 6.0 or equivalent.

If you do not meet the English language requirements you may apply to study a University-approved English language program.
